Output 90f6a33820319e75a373aace32585fe950b05a860f9a131b196fa511d676ebb3:1

value
1105770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fae959522b27d8e98c967732e7b58d350108b962 OP_EQUAL
address
3QZiPsHm6roe94mXUxe9CVXUyA22izus5T
transaction
90f6a33820319e75a373aace32585fe950b05a860f9a131b196fa511d676ebb3
confirmations
234287
spent
true